The Czech Embassy organized a concert of classical music on the occasion of the Czech Presidency to the EU, the Europe Day and the 5th anniversary of the EU enlargement in 2004. The concert took place in the Small Hall in the Oslo Konserthus on Tuesday 5 May 2009. More then 200 guests were welcome by the Ambassador Luboš Nový and 11 musicians performed. Four Norwegian students of piano professor Jiří Hlinka presented the music of W. A. Mozart, B. Smetana, L. Janáček and M. Ravel. Young musicians, students and teachers from Kutná Hora Music and Art school played piano, guitar, flute, violin and violoncello. World premiere of piano piece from Norwegian composer Filip Sande was played by Kateřina Škarková.
